1. Understanding Arrow Spine



What is Arrow Spine?



Arrow spine refers to the stiffness of an arrow shaft. It determines how much an arrow flexes when released from the bow. Think of it as the backbone of your arrow, influencing its flight trajectory and impact on the target.



Importance of Arrow Spine



The proper arrow spine is crucial for consistent and accurate shooting. Too stiff or too flexible, and your arrow may veer off course, missing the mark entirely. Understanding and calculating arrow spine is the key to optimizing your archery performance.



2. Anatomy of an Arrow



To comprehend arrow spine, let's dissect the anatomy of an arrow.



Shaft



The shaft is the main body of the arrow, typically made of materials like carbon, aluminum, or wood. It is the primary component responsible for arrow spine.



Fletching



Fletching, located at the rear of the arrow, consists of feathers or plastic vanes. It stabilizes the arrow during flight, counteracting any unwanted spins.



Arrowhead



The arrowhead, positioned at the front, is the pointy end that pierces the target. Its weight and design affect the arrow's balance and penetration power.



3. Factors Affecting Arrow Spine



Several factors influence arrow spine, including:











  • Arrow Length: Longer arrows tend to be more flexible.








  • Arrow Material: Different materials have varying degrees of stiffness.








  • Draw Weight: Higher draw weights require stiffer arrows to maintain stability.








  • Arrow Weight: Heavier arrows flex less than lighter ones.

1. How do I determine my arrow's spine?



To determine your arrow's spine, you'll need to consider factors like draw weight, arrow length, and arrow material. Arrow spine calculators can streamline this process, providing tailored recommendations for your setup.



2. Can I use a general arrow spine calculator for any bow?



While some arrow spine calculators offer versatility, it's advisable to choose one that aligns with your specific bow type, draw weight, and shooting style for optimal results.



3. What happens if my arrow spine is too stiff?



An arrow spine that is too stiff can result in erratic flight patterns, causing arrows to veer off course or miss the target altogether. Adjusting your arrow spine to better match your bow setup can mitigate this issue.



4. Is arrow spine the same for all arrow materials?



No, arrow spine varies depending on the material used for the arrow shaft. Different materials exhibit different levels of stiffness, requiring adjustments in spine rating for optimal performance.
